    Try using iTunes Folder Watch to work out where iTunes "thinks" your missing files should be. Generally the whole iTunes folder is portable provided that all the media is inside the *iTunes Music/iTunes Media* folder which in turn is in the folder where the *iTunes Library.itl* file is stored. If you don't start off with this layout then iTunes won't track files when you move the folder.

    TIP: For insurance against the iPhoto database corruption that many users have experienced I recommend making a backup copy of the Library6.iPhoto database file and keep it current. If problems crop up where iPhoto suddenly can't see any photos or thinks there are no photos in the library, replacing the working Library6.iPhoto file with the backup will often get the library back. By keeping it current I mean backup after each import and/or any serious editing or work on books, slideshows, calendars, cards, etc. That insures that if a problem pops up and you do need to replace the database file, you'll retain all those efforts. It doesn't take long to make the backup and it's good insurance.

  • Missing songs and Playlists: how to restore from Time Machine

    Here's my story. I synced my iPod a week ago before vacation (and this was backed up with Time Machine). When I returned and launched iTunes, I found that all my playlists and podcasts had disappeared. I also noticed that on my iPod I had ~4500 songs; iTunes has only 4100, so I'm missing about 400 songs.
    If I open up Time Machine and restore my my whole iTunes folder (in User>Music) will that, theoretically, restore all my songs?
    If I've added new Music to iTunes (that wasn't in the TM backup), will those songs be over-written by the week-old backup?
    It's too tedious (and not at all obvious) which songs are missing, so hoping Time Machine can come to my rescue.
    Thanks!
    Message was edited by: Argelius

    Argelius wrote:
    Here's my story. I synced my iPod a week ago before vacation (and this was backed up with Time Machine). When I returned and launched iTunes, I found that all my playlists and podcasts had disappeared. I also noticed that on my iPod I had ~4500 songs; iTunes has only 4100, so I'm missing about 400 songs.
    If I open up Time Machine and restore my my whole iTunes folder (in User>Music) will that, theoretically, restore all my songs?
    yes.
    If I've added new Music to iTunes (that wasn't in the TM backup), will those songs be over-written by the week-old backup?
    yes, they will.
    It's too tedious (and not at all obvious) which songs are missing, so hoping Time Machine can come to my rescue.
    You can do the following. in "view options" in iTunes add a column "date added". sort by that column and back up all the songs added since the time of the last backup. quit itunes and restore the old library and the old itunes preference file. start itunes and import the songs you've backed up.
